Rivian and Volkswagen Group Technologies

Sr. Technical Program Manager

Company: Rivian And Volkswagen Group Technologies

Location: Palo Alto, CA

Posted on: April 10

About Us

Rivian and Volkswagen Group Technologies is a joint venture between two industry leaders with a clear vision for automotives next chapter. From operating systems to zonal controllers to cloud and connectivity solutions, were addressing the challenges of electric vehicles through technology that will set the standards for software-defined vehicles around the world.

The road to the future is uncharted. By combining our expertise across connectivity, AI, security and more, well map a new way forward. Working together, well create a future thats more connected, more intelligent, more sustainable for everyone.

Role Summary

Are you a highly experienced Technical Program Manager with a proven track record of successfully delivering high-quality software for evolving product platforms in complex, integrated software-hardware environments? We are seeking a dynamic and results-oriented individual to take a leading role in managing the software delivery for our existing vehicle line as well as supporting new product development initiatives and production ramp. As a critical member of our Software Technical Program Team, you will be instrumental in ensuring the seamless integration of new features and launching new product variants, while upholding the highest standards of software quality.

Responsibilities

  • Define and execute comprehensive software program plans for software impacting changes for new vehicle variants and new software features, for both consumer and commercial vehicles
  • Align software release plans to company and program milestones
  • Drive software-hardware integration efforts
  • Cultivate strong working relationships and effectively collaborate with cross-functional teams outside of the software organization to ensure seamless software integration and successful launch of new features and product variants
  • Take ownership of prioritizing and driving the swift resolution of software issues that arise during the development of new features and product variants
  • Coordinate verification test plans tailored to the unique software and hardware configurations of new product variants
  • Deliver clear, concise, and insightful updates on the progress of software delivery to the program team, executive leadership, and key stakeholders
  • Proactively identify potential risks to software delivery timelines or quality, implementing effective mitigation strategies and healthily escalating concerns as needed
  • Identify and execute continuous process improvements

Qualifications

  • BS or MS in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or a closely related technical field
  • 10+ years of progressive Technical or Engineering Program Management experience, demonstrating a strong and successful track record in software delivery for complex, integrated software-hardware products
  • Experience leading the development and launch of at least 3 new products into production that involve software and electrical hardware
  • Exceptional communication, interpersonal, and collaboration skills, with a proven ability to effectively influence and lead cross-functional teams in a fast-paced environment
  • Deep expertise in both Agile and Waterfall development methodologies, with practical and advanced proficiency in Jira and other program management tools to manage complex software delivery

Preferred Qualifications

  • Previous experience as a software or hardware product development engineer
  • Experience with over-the-air (OTA) software update strategies and deployment for connected devices or systems
  • Experience in the automotive industry
